On Wednesday, May 28, Miles Finn will be presenting on the Connecticut Bar Association webinar titled, “Leveraging AI: Practical Applications and Insights for Practitioners.”

The rapid growth of artificial intelligence (AI) usage has led to many complex legal, ethical, and practical questions. Perhaps the most front of mind for many practitioners is simply: “Should I be engaging with this new technology at all, and if so, how?” This CLE aims to provide practitioners with practical, everyday examples (particularly in the intellectual property space) of how AI platforms can be used to enhance an attorney’s practice, while also balancing the discussion with best practices firms are implementing to mitigate the risks associated with the usage of this technology.
